ブルームバーグの分析によると、欧州のガソリン利幅が回復し、原油価格に対するプレミアムは25ドル拡大した。

By

-- ブルームバーグが月曜日に発表した分析によると、北西ヨーロッパのガソリン価格は金曜日、原油価格に対して1バレルあたり17ドル以上のプレミアムを上乗せし、週間で約25ドル上昇した。 この分析によると、ガソリン価格の原油価格に対するプレミアムの急上昇は、イラン紛争に起因する原油価格高騰による圧力から製油所が回復したことによるものだという。 この反発は、以前の急落に続くもので、価格変動は主に製油所の経済性に直接影響を与える現物原油価格の変動によって引き起こされている。 4月上旬には、ブレント原油価格の急騰によりガソリン価格はマイナス圏に転落したが、原油価格が下落したことで、ガソリン価格はブレント原油価格に対して再びプレミアムを上回ったと、同分析は付け加えている。

LG CNS, OpenAI to Expand ChatGPT Edu in Education AX Market

LG CNS (KRX:064400) and OpenAI signed a reseller agreement to expand ChatGPT Edu in the education AX market, the South Korean AX specialist said in a Monday release.ChatGPT Edu supports several tasks such as generating lecture materials, organizing research data and reports, and providing personalized tutoring. The product also offers enterprise-grade security, the release said.Key universities such as Arizona State University, the University of California, San Francisco System, and Harvard University have already adopted ChatGPT Edu. Looking ahead, LG CNS plans to offer introductory tour programs for ChatGPT Edu across major universities in the Seoul metropolitan area, along with conducting AI education seminars, it said.LG CNS may partner with universities and OpenAI to develop ChatGPT Edu-based AI curricula and host hackathons, the release said.

NS Solutions' Profit Rises 14% in Fiscal Year Ended March

NS Solutions' (TYO:2327) profit attributable to owners of the parent climbed 14% to 30.8 billion yen for the fiscal year ended March 31 from 27 billion yen a year earlier.The IT solution company's earnings per share increased to 168.50 yen from 147.84 yen a year ago, according to a Tokyo bourse filing on Monday.Revenue jumped 13% to 381.3 billion yen from 338.3 billion yen in the prior year.In a separate disclosure, NS Solutions raised its final dividend payout to 45 yen per share from 40 yen planned earlier, payable from June 2.For the fiscal year ending March 31, 2027, the company expects attributable profit of 31.6 billion yen, basic EPS of 172.70 yen, and revenue of 417 billion yen.NS Solutions plans to pay interim and year-end dividends of 43.50 yen per share, each, for the year, which is higher than the amount paid in the year-ago period.
